Electric Fireplace Wall Mounted Electric fireplaces mounted on walls are a great method to provide warmth and comfort to your workplace or home. They're also very secure. They plug into an electrical outlet and many models offer supplemental heating. They are also less expensive than fireplaces that are recessed. You can install them yourself or you can have an expert do it. Safety A wall-mounted electric fireplace is the ideal option for those looking to add a cozy feel and contemporary ambiance to their homes or apartments, condos or offices without taking up too much space. They come in a broad range of sizes and designs to fit any space, from large to small, and they can even be customized using a variety of designs and colors. A lot of them have glowing flames and embers that can create a peaceful atmosphere in any room. They can provide warmth and style in any space. However they must be installed properly to ensure safety and optimal performance. To decrease the chance of fire, materials that could ignite must be kept at a distance of 3 feet or more from the unit. The vents that blow out the hot air must be kept open and unblocked. This allows the hot air to move more efficiently throughout the room and lead to an efficient heating. The majority of wall-mounted electric fireplaces include instructions on how to install them properly in a home or workplace. The instructions usually contain step-by-step images or videos of the actual installation process so that people can follow them easily. Some require the help of a professional to set up them in a commercial or residential building, but most are easy to install. The most important factor to consider is to select a model that has CSA certification and an automatic shutoff feature in case of a short-circuit or excessive heat. The majority of models also have thermostats that regulate the temperature level, meaning you can set the temperature you prefer in your home or business. It is also important to turn off the fireplace when you leave the home or retire to bed. This will not only save money on energy costs but also assist in preventing fire hazards. Verify that the cord isn't in contact with anything to the elements, or is not in contact with anything that could ignite in the event of an overheated circuit. Convenience Electric fireplace wall mounted are a great option for people who want an attractive, practical accent to their living room but don't have the space for a traditional gas or wood fireplace. They are easy to install and come with the brackets needed to hang them as an image or TV. They're also ventless, so you don't have to worry about a chimney, or smoke. Additionally, you can control the flames and heat by using the remote. Most fireplaces include a mantel and various design options, so you can match them to your decor. For instance, you can opt for a wood-finished finish to go with a rustic or country-style, while black metal fireplaces go well with modern and contemporary designs. Some models can be built into the wall for a custom-fitted look, while others are freestanding and can be put anywhere in your home. Another thing to consider is the amount of heat the fireplace will produce. You can pick from models that only provide a calming glow or those with up to 1500W of heating power. The first is more energy efficient and will save you money on electricity while the latter is perfect for zone heating or additional heating. In addition to the flames and ember bed, some models will also have a backlight that can be changed from white to red or dim. This creates a romantic and dramatic atmosphere, which is particularly helpful in smaller areas. Some models have a thermostat in them that allows you to set the desired temperature. The fireplace will then increase or decrease its temperature to match that setting. You can use the heating function without the flames, if you prefer to enjoy the warmth of the fireplace. Although it is possible to install a recessed or wall-mounted electric fireplace yourself, it's almost always better to get an expert to ensure the job is done correctly and safely. Depending on the size of the fireplace you select, it might be necessary to build an additional framework or box to support it and make sure it's securely secured against the wall. You should also take measurements of the area where the fireplace will be placed before purchasing it. This means you won't end up with a fireplace too big or small. Installation Some electric fires, depending on the model that you choose, are semi-permanent. They will need to connect to a wall with the wall bracket or mounting screws. Check the instructions that come with your fireplace to find the right direction. If you're not confident in drilling into a wall you might want to employ a professional electrician to complete the task for you. First, you'll need to decide where the wall mounted fireplace will be placed. It's important to do this before starting because it will allow you to ensure that the fireplace is installed in a safe place and is a good fit for the room you choose. You'll also need to be sure that there is a power outlet nearby – it must be near enough to plug the fireplace in without the need for an extension cable, however make sure it isn't located too near to any combustible items like curtains or furniture. After you have chosen a location for the electric fireplace, you will need to prepare the wall. If you're installing it in an drywall wall, you'll need to cut two 2x6s an inch smaller than the final wall height, and then mark the centres of the studs and the centre point on each plate with pencil. Drill holes for the mounting bracket. Make sure they are properly spaced, in accordance with the instructions of your fireplace. Some models of wall-mounted electric fires come with an outline of the locations where holes must be dug. Mark the wall using an apex of a pencil and a level. Then utilize the rawl plugs that come in your fire to secure them into the holes in the walls. Then, you can hang the glass in front of the fireplace after it is securely in place. Connect it to the wall, and enjoy! For additional convenience you can also include the remote.
